F4U Corsair. Model Engineering. Truly Scratch-Built. One-Off Models.
1:15 Scale. Model Engineering. One-Off Aluminum Models. Truly Scratch-Built.
The custom metal models built by Guillermo Rojas Bazán are considered the best in the world in their category by several institutions of wide international prestige such as the Department of Aerospace and Mechanical Engineering at the University of Notre Dame, the National Museum of the United States Air Force and Christie's South Kensington. He has worked as a professional model maker in four different countries building over 150 aluminum models in different scales for museums, collectors and aviation art galleries around the world during 38 years. See the related story:
